#410450 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#410450 is composed of 25.5% red, 1.6%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 18.8% cyan, 95% magenta, 0% yellow and 68.6% black. It has a hue angle of 288.2 degrees, a saturation of 90.5% and a lightness of 16.5%. #410450 color hex could be obtained by blending #8208a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

#410450 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#410450 has RGB values of R:65, G:4,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0.19,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.69. Its decimal value is 4260944.
